Description
The need for a modular system of study in the University in general and in Communication Skills in particular has been necessitated by two issues. The first issue concerns the increased demand for higher education in Kenya that requires universities to broaden access and inclusion to a greater range of students. This is driven by the twin agendas of increasing economic competitiveness on the national and world economic stage and promoting greater social equality by extending access to students from under-represented groups. In addition, the increasing importance attached to the ‘knowledge economy’ and to ‘lifelong learning’ is encouraging more
mature-age, working students to return to formal education to enhance their professional
knowledge and skills. These changes in access have necessitated a move to more adaptable
curricular: modularity and flexibility in course structures and delivery. Thus, universities are having to actively implement systems and approaches in teaching and learning environments; for example, by means of electronic platforms and applications for course delivery, teaching and
learning support.

UCI 301 LESSON 7: SOFTWARE CONFIGURATION MANAGEMENT
Trending!
Software configuration management is an umbrella activity that is applied throughout the software process. Because change can occur at any time, SCM activities are developed to;
1. Identify change
2. Control change
3. Ensure that change is being properly implemented
4. Report change to others who may have an interest

UCI 301 LESSON 8: RISK MANAGEMENT
Trending!
Risk management is the systematic process of planning for, identifying, analyzing, responding to, and monitoring project risks. It involves processes, tools, and techniques that will help the project manager maximize the probability and results of positive events and minimize the probability and consequences of adverse events as indicated and appropriate within the context of risk to the overall project objectives of cost, time, scope and quality.
